Understanding the Dental Implant Procedure

The dental implant procedure is both intricate and personalized, designed to ensure a seamless experience for each patient. Initially, the dentist will conduct a thorough assessment, including x-rays and health evaluations, to determine the feasibility of the treatment. This step is crucial as it helps in planning the entire process according to the patient’s unique dental structure and health status.
Once deemed suitable, the actual implantation begins with the surgical placement of titanium posts into the jawbone. These posts function as artificial roots and provide a sturdy foundation for the replacement teeth. After this phase, patients will undergo a healing period, typically lasting several months, during which the bone integrates with the implant, forming a stable support system.
Finally, after sufficient healing, the dentist will attach custom-made crowns that match the surrounding teeth in color and shape. This restoration not only improves functionality but also enhances the aesthetic appeal of the patient’s smile.
The Benefits of Dental Implants
Dental implants come with numerous benefits that make them a compelling choice for tooth replacement. First and foremost, they restore full chewing capacity, allowing patients to enjoy their favorite foods without restrictions. Unlike dentures, which can slip or cause discomfort, dental implants are securely anchored, providing a stable solution for eating and speaking.
In addition to functional advantages, dental implants significantly enhance one’s appearance. By mimicking natural teeth, they help to maintain the integrity of the facial structure, preventing the sunken look that often accompanies tooth loss. As a result, patients feel more confident in social interactions, positively impacting their overall quality of life.
Lastly, dental implants promote long-term oral health. They do not require alterations to adjacent teeth, as is common with bridges, thus preserving more of the natural tooth structure. Additionally, implants help stimulate the jawbone, reducing the risk of bone loss and further dental issues down the line.
Types of Dental Implants Explained
There are primarily two types of dental implants: endosteal and subperiosteal. Endosteal implants, the most common type, are inserted directly into the jawbone. These implants are typically made of titanium, a biocompatible material that allows for optimal integration with bone over time.
On the other hand, subperiosteal implants are placed beneath the gum but above the jawbone. This type is usually selected for patients with minimal bone height who may not be suitable candidates for traditional implants. Each type of implant has its own set of advantages and considerations, which should be thoroughly discussed with a dental professional.
Patients may also have options for different implant systems and designs tailored to their specific situation. Consulting with a knowledgeable dentist is essential to determine the best approach based on individual needs and conditions.
The Importance of Aftercare and Maintenance
Caring for dental implants is critical to ensure their longevity and functionality. After the initial healing period, patients must adopt a diligent oral hygiene routine, which includes regular brushing and flossing. Just like natural teeth, implants require attention to prevent the accumulation of plaque and bacteria that could lead to infection.
Regular dental check-ups are also crucial. These visits allow the dentist to monitor the health of the implants and surrounding tissues. Professional cleanings and assessments will help identify any potential issues early, ensuring the patient maintains optimal oral health.
Lastly, lifestyle choices can influence the longevity of dental implants. Avoiding tobacco and excessive alcohol can have a significant impact on healing and overall dental health. Patients are encouraged to follow their dentists recommendations for a healthy lifestyle that supports implant success.
